Neymar informs teammates of his decision to leave
According to Spanish outlet Mundo Deportivo, Barcelona superstar Neymar has informed his teammates of his decision to leave the Camp Nou outfit to join Paris Saint-Germain. The Brazilian will not return to Spain following the culmination of the Blaugrana’s pre-season tour of the United States and will instead travel to France to put pen to paper on his new contract.
Paulo Dybala on Barcelona’s radar to replace Neymar
With the talks of Neymar leaving Barcelona growing day by day, it is being reported by Diario Sport, that the Catalan outfit have identified Juventus forward Paulo Dybala as the ideal candidate to fill the huge void left by the Brazilian’s departure.
Dybala – whose playing style has been likened to Lionel Messi – scored twice for the Old Lady in the UEFA Champions League quarter-final clash against the Camp Nou outfit.
Jesus Navas close to securing Sevilla return
Jesus Navas joined Manchester City in 2013, having spent his entire playing career with Sevilla and it appears now that the Spaniard is close to securing a return to his boyhood club, according to Spanish news outlet Marca. The 31-year-old was one of 5 first-team players released by the Etihad outfit at the end of last season and he is close to returning to the club of his dreams.
